What Are the Ingredients for Spicy Thai Noodles?

You do not need to worry that you will not be able to find the ingredients for this recipe because they are going to be very easy to find. Just give your local grocery store a visit and collect what you need. There are only three basic things that you need for this dish. Those things are the noodles. the spicy sauce, and the garnish. You can also add whatever kind of protein that you want to your dish. Here are some ingredients that you will need.

  • Noodles: any kind of pasta from linguine, fettuccine, or spaghetti (1 lb).
  • Sauce: red pepper flakes (½ – 1 ½ tbsp), vegetable oil (2 tbsp), toasted sesame oil (1/3 – ½ cup), chili paste (1 ½ tsp), soy sauce (6 tbsp), honey (6 tbsp).
  • Garnish: carrots, peanuts, cilantro, sesame seeds.
  • Protein: chicken, pork, shrimp, tofu.

These ingredients will provide you with 6 servings of spicy Thai noodles. The prep time is approximately 5 minutes, whereas the cooking time is only 15 minutes. If you total that with the 5 minutes cooling time, the total time that you would need to cook this dish is approximately 25 minutes.

Spicy Thai Noodles

If you are bored of always having mac and cheese for dinner, then you can consider literally spicing it up with spicy Thai noodles. Spicy Thai noodles are perfect when it comes to adding flavor and variety to your dinner.

  • Noodles: any kind of pasta from linguine, fettuccine, or spaghetti (1 lb)
  • Sauce: red pepper flakes (½ – 1 ½ tbsp), vegetable oil (2 tbsp), toasted sesame oil (1/3 – ½ cup), chili paste (1 ½ tsp), soy sauce (6 tbsp), honey (6 tbsp)
  • Garnish: carrots, peanuts, cilantro, sesame seeds.
  • Protein: chicken, pork, shrimp, tofu.
  1. Boil some water to cook your pasta.

  2. Chop the carrots and cilantro to be used as a garnish, set them aside.

  3. Pull out a large skillet, add 2 tablespoons of vegetable oil and half a cup of toasted sesame oil. Heat the oils.

  4. Add the red pepper flakes as desired up to one and a half tablespoons.

  5. Strain the red pepper flakes, reserve the oil in a bowl.

  6. Add the reserved oil into the skillet again.

  7. Add one and a half teaspoons of chili paste, six tablespoons of soy sauce, and six tablespoons of honey. Mix them all together.

  8. Add a protein of your choice. You can use chicken, pork, shrimp, or tofu.

  9. Add your cooked pasta, mix the pasta with the sauce.

  10. op up your dish with some garnish.
